## Further reading

If you're reviewing the Sudsport locker access flow, start with the token-exchange sequence diagram — it covers how short-lived open codes get minted and why we never cache them client-side. The threat model doc is honestly the best overview we have. Both documents, plus the audit notes from last quarter, are collected on this page:

wiki page, fahaf-yagag: https://confluence.qorvellabs.internal/pages/display/pages/display

**Handover: Purgewright retention sweeper**

Handing this off before I'm out next week. Purgewright is mid-migration to the new deletion-manifest format — the Ostvale cluster is done, the rest are queued for Thursday. If a sweep stalls, just requeue it; don't force-delete anything manually. One important thing for the release cut: the sweeper's config vault re-seals on every deploy, and you'll need to unseal it before the smoke tests pass. To save you a scramble, the recovery passphrase is written just below.

unlock words, fafop-hawep: briwyn-oliix-sorox

**Visitor policy: First-aid room.** The first-aid room at Dunmore Exchange is located on the ground floor, opposite the goods entrance, and is available to visiting contractors in the event of any injury on site. Please report all incidents to your site contact, however minor, so they can be logged. The room is kept locked to protect supplies; contractors who are first-aid trained and responding to an incident may use the door code below:

door code, yagap-bahof: bdg-O-05